Palo Santo is one of the trees that is currently positioning itself as one of the most popular aromatic woods and this is thanks to its multiple properties.

Its woody citrus scent with a slight scent of Mint is both easily recognizable and its use is increasingly widespread. “Palo Santo” means “sacred wood” its scientific name is bursera graveolens and it is originally from South America and, as such, is widely used for spiritual purposes. Many claim that it has healing and calming powers, which is why it has fascinated civilizations since ancient times.

Among other things, it was widely used by Inca shamans in their religious and spiritual rituals, as a perfect tool to attract good luck, ward off negativity, and achieve better spiritual communication with their gods. Today, this “sacred wood” never ceases to amaze us: new uses and forms of application are increasingly known.

Palo Santo is part of the citrus family and has sweet undertones of pine, mint, and lemon. Its wood contains an evident aroma when burned as wood or distilled to be used as an essential oil.

Body scrub recipe:

The first step to taking care of your body in winter and removing dead skin is to exfoliate once a week.

Ingredients:

  • Olive oil
  • essential oil of Palo Santo
  • Honey
  • Sea salt.
  • Step 1: In a bowl, combine 3 tablespoons of olive oil, a tablespoon of runny honey, and 4 tablespoons of sea salt.
  • Step 2: Add 2 drops of PaloSanto essential oil.
  • Step 3: Apply the scrub to the body in circular motions to fully exfoliate
  • Step 4: rinse.

Moisturizing hand cream recipe:

To look beautiful up to your fingertips, don’t forget to take special care of your hands with a moisturizer. Here’s a homemade recipe for soft hands:

Ingredients:

  • 50 g of shea butter
  • 30ml of vegetable oil
  • 8ml of beeswax
  • 20 drops of essential oil for smell
  • 6 drops of vitamin E
  • Step 1: Melt the beeswax and vegetable butter in a double boiler
  • Step 2: Remove the mixture from the heat and add the vegetable oil, essential oil and vitamin E
  • Step 3: Mix and pour the preparation into a container.
  • Step 4: Let the cream cool and harden.
  • Step 5: Apply it to your hands!
